Finally, a challenge. Who has the worst writing in this show?Luna has the worst writing in all of MLP.
It really is all over the place, since it's an awful lot of writers trying to capture the same character. A bit like comic book writing; It can head anywhere from awesome to awful.
Luna: While not the worst written, she lacks a lot of characterization. As NMM, she's ends up as a muhahaha saturday morning villain. As Luna, she's essentially a less renowned version of her sister. Outside of invading CMC's Dreamscapes, there's not much going on there. Going back to "I was NMM so I know the feel sis" is getting old.
Celestia: Possibly worse. She spills exposition, and apparently drinks an appletini while the Mane 6 take care of the villains. Princess Twi and Twilight's Kingdom try to eliminate this enlarged plot hole by imprisoning her instead. She's dumbledore.
Twilight: She's like an annoying muscle car next to a bunch of pintos. In Season 1, she's little miss Perfect. As great as Lesson Zero is, they're stretching the character a bit much to remove Mary Sue Syndrome. I mean, why not just ask Celestia herself instead of freaking out? I thought she was the smart one. In Twilight's Kingdom, she's an Overpowered Emo turned magical battery pack. The writers have a reeeeally hard time handling her.
I'm voting twilight as the worst written. I'm voting Luna as the least written.
